Barcelona's full list of injured players and possible return dates for six key players

Barcelona currently has six important players injured and the approximate dates when they can return are already known.
The 2023/24 season has not been so positive for Barcelona, as in addition to disappointing results, they have also encountered other problems.
One of the main problems of the Blaugranes have been the constant injuries of the players.
Barcelona already have six key players out and the Telegraph have been told when they could return.
Gavi - September
The teenager is still recovering from the ACL ligament injury he suffered on international duty with Spain in November 2023.
The left-back has undergone surgery on a back injury he suffered in December 2023. He is now expected to miss two months in recovery.
Marc-Andre ter Stegen - mid-February
The reliable goalkeeper is close to full recovery after back surgery. He is one of the victims of injuries from the matches with the national team in November 2023.
It's a hamstring problem again for Raphinha. The Brazilian left the game in the first half of Barca's 2-0 win against Osasuna. As happened before, Raphinha is likely to be out for a month.
Inigo Martinez - end of January
The Spanish defender is unlikely to kick the ball in the Spanish Super Cup final this Sunday. Martinez has a hamstring problem and he would recover in weeks, not days.
Joao Cancelo - mid-January
Cancelo's knee should be good enough to allow him to play some minutes against Real Madrid on January 14. Barca need him as they have struggled on the defensive flanks.
